Simon Evans.

Stood for Reform UK in West Lancashire at the 2024 General Election. Not elected — so there is no parliamentary record to show, but here is the contest in full and where the seat stands now.

Finished 3rd of 5 with 7,909 votes (17.9%).

The result in full · 2024 General Election

CandidatePartyVotesShare
Ashley Dalton✓ electedLab22,30550.5%
Mike PrendergastCon8,68019.6%
Simon EvansRef7,90917.9%
Charlotte HoultramGreen3,2637.4%
Graham SmithLD2,0434.6%

Majority 13,625 · 44,200 votes cast.
